New and used car parts in category Valves comaptible with Dacia
2 products found
SKU: AUX-REN7700103938
High availability
1.89 USD
0.00% Tax incl.
SKU: AUX-REN7700103938
High availability
1.99 USD
0.00% Tax incl.
Filters